Can I send marketing SMS messages from my Shopify store using an app?
Yes, absolutely. Apps like Postscript, SMSBump, and Attentive are specifically designed to help Shopify store owners send marketing SMS messages legally and effectively. They handle consent management, message templating, campaign scheduling, and performance tracking.
What are the key features to look for in a Shopify SMS marketing app?
Key features include seamless Shopify integration, robust segmentation capabilities, automated workflows (like abandoned cart, browse abandonment), compliance tools, detailed analytics, list growth tools, and high message deliverability. Ease of use and customer support are also vital.

Does Shopify have its own SMS marketing app?
Shopify itself does not offer a native, built-in SMS marketing app with the depth of features found in third-party solutions. However, they do allow integration with numerous dedicated SMS marketing apps through the Shopify App Store, such as Postscript, Klaviyo SMS, and many others.
How do I ensure SMS compliance for my Shopify store?
The best SMS apps for Shopify, like Postscript, have built-in compliance features. This includes easy ways to obtain explicit customer consent (opt-in), provide clear opt-out instructions in every message, and adhere to regulations like TCPA and GDPR. Always choose an app that prioritizes compliance.
